(a) The county sheriff shall return, upon every order of attachment, what he or she has done under it.
(b)(1) The return must show the property attached, the time it was attached, and the disposition made of it.
(2) Where garnishees are summoned, their names and the time each was summoned must be stated.
(3) Where real property is attached, the county sheriff shall describe it with sufficient certainty to identify it, and where he or she can do so, a reference to the deed or title under which the defendant holds it.
(c) The county sheriff shall return with the order all bonds taken under it.
